physitheism
physitheism (ˈfɪzɪθɪˌɪzəm) n1. (Other Non-Christian Religions) the attribution of physical form to gods and religious beings2. (Other Non-Christian Religions) the worship of nature and the assignment of gods to natural phenomenaphysitheism1. the assignment of a physical form to a god. 2. the deification and worship of natural phenomena; physiolatry.See also: Nature 1. the assignment to God of a physical shape. 2. deification of the powers or phenomena of nature.See also: God and Gods |
